Key Prioritization for CFOs and Finance Leaders Around the World. We are pleased to announce FEI Utah at the World Trade Center in downtown Salt Lake City for Protiviti's Global Finance Trends Survey (GFTS). The survey provides insights into the top priorities of CFOs and finance leaders around the world.

 Learning Objectives:

  • Identify the top priorities for CFOs and finance leaders in 2026, including data security, strategic planning, and FP&A.
  • Recognize critical approaches to managing cybersecurity risks and regulatory compliance in finance.
  • Examine the emerging cybersecurity risks and opportunities introduced by AI in finance operations, including internal vulnerabilities and evolving regulatory requirements.
  • Gain practical insights into strengthening cross-functional collaboration and building a resilient, technology-enabled finance organization.
  • Describe key action items for CFOs and finance leaders going into 2026.
